We are looking to appoint 2 X 0.5FTE Professional Tutors in Fine Art who will contribute to teaching and research activity in the School of Creative and Performing Arts. 
 The post will encompass teaching, administration, pastoral support and ongoing programme development in-line with the needs of the school. The appointed candidate will have an established contemporary arts practice and a strong of track record of professional activity and/or practice-based research. 
 Candidates will have a good honours degree and a Masters-level qualification in Fine Art (or a related discipline). Candidates should also demonstrate experience of HE-level teaching/scholarship and the ability to establish links with cultural partners for the enhancement of curricula. 
 You will join a dedicated team who work closely together. The School is fully committed to excellence in teaching, to enhancing the student experience, and increasingly to delivering research/professional experience. 
 The University is committed to working with industry and cultural and creative organisations to design and develop curriculum that is relevant and related to the missions of these organisations and the development of the city. Currently the University has formal partnership with Liverpool Tate, National Museums Liverpool and the Bluecoat Art Centre amongst others. The University wishes to build on existing links with international partners, providing exchange opportunities for study abroad students as well as hosting international renowned artists and scholars.
